biopharmaceutical

noun

bio·​phar·​ma·​ceu·​ti·​cal ˌbī-ō-ˌfär-mə-ˈsü-ti-kəl How to pronounce biopharmaceutical (audio)
: a pharmaceutical derived from biological sources and especially one produced by biotechnology
biopharmaceutical adjective
